Hyponyms (each of the following is a kind of "duty"): legal duty (acts which the law requires be done or forborne), prerequisite; requirement (something that is required in advance), white man's burden (the supposed responsibility of the white race to provide care for their non-white subjects), line of duty (all that is normally required in some area of responsibility), incumbency (a duty that is incumbent upon you), imperative (some duty that is essential and urgent), filial duty (duty of a child to its parents), civic duty; civic responsibility (the responsibilities of a citizen), burden of proof (the duty of proving a disputed charge), noblesse oblige (the obligation of those of high rank to be honorable and generous (often used ironically)), moral obligation (an obligation arising out of considerations of right and wrong), guardianship; keeping; safekeeping (the responsibility of a guardian or keeper), duteous (willingly obedient out of a sense of duty and respect), Work that you are obliged to perform for moral or legal reasons, work (activity directed toward making or doing something), function; office; part; role (the actions and activities assigned to or required or expected of a person or group), assignment; duty assignment (a duty that you are assigned to perform (especially in the armed forces)), chore; job; task (a specific piece of work required to be done as a duty or for a specific fee), Nouns denoting possession and transfer of possession, they signed a treaty to lower duties on trade between their countries, indirect tax (a tax levied on goods or services rather than on persons or organizations), custom; customs; customs duty; impost (money collected under a tariff), tonnage; tonnage duty; tunnage (a tax imposed on ships that enter the US; based on the tonnage of the ship), octroi (a tax on various goods brought into a town), revenue tariff (a tariff imposed to raise revenue), protective tariff (a tariff imposed to protect domestic firms from import competition), countervailing duty (a duty imposed to offset subsidies by foreign governments). Proving the duty (such as not to be negligent, to keep premises safe, or to drive within the speed limit) and then showing that the duty was breached are required elements of any lawsuit for damages due to negligence or intentional injuries. Duty of candour – what it means to you Duty of candour means NHS organisations have a legal duty to inform and apologise to patients if mistakes have been made in the delivery of their care or treatment, or where moderate or severe harm has been caused.
